International Trade Centre opens ahead of Canadian Western Agribition
Description
November 6, 2017
Mon, Nov 6: The International Trade Centre at Evraz Place officially opened its doors today. The new facility will be home to Canadian Western Agribition and will host several other events throughout the year. As Marney Blunt tells us, it's already attracting the attention of agricultural producers from around the world.
